Non-precision Approaches and Systems
- Localizer
- VOR – VHF Omnidirectional Range
- NDB – Non-Directional Beacon with complementary Automatic Direction Finder (ADF) installed on board
- LDA – Localizer Type Directional Aid
- SDF – Simplified Directional Facility
- GPS – Global Positioning System (with or without vertical navigation capability, which usually requires extra precision typically afforded by using WAAS, EGNOS, or other signal correction systems)
- TACAN – Tactical Air Navigation
- SRA – Surveillance Radar Approach (known in some countries as an ASR approach)
- ASR – Airport Surveillance Radar (military designation for SRA)
